Greenpeace declares war on coal
June 16, 2008
GREENPEACE has called for all coal-fired power stations to be shut down by 2030 as part of a radical energy plan
The environment group wants an immediate ban on new coal-fired power stations - and extensions to existing plants - and for the Federal Government to start planning on shutting them down for good.
The group has released a roadmap - Australia's Energy (R)evolution - to turn the tide of increasing greenhouse-gas emissions.
"Avoiding catastrophic climate change means an inevitable phasing out of coal," the roadmap said.
